The Complexities of Surrogacy: Ethical and Legal Considerations

Surrogacy, a process utilizing a woman to carry and deliver a child for other individuals, presents a myriad of moral challenges. Legally, surrogacy arrangements can be highly contentious and vary widely across jurisdictions. Key concerns include the welfare of the surrogate, informed consent processes, monetary considerations, and the potential for exploitation. Furthermore, surrogacy raises philosophical questions about family structures and the commodification of reproduction.

  • Establishing clear legal frameworks is essential to ensure the well-being of all parties involved in surrogacy arrangements.
  • Honest dialogue between involved individuals is crucial to navigate the challenges of surrogacy ethically and legally.
